Position Summary

We are looking for a detail-oriented Structural Steel Quality Assurance Inspector to support quality operations in a structural steel fabrication facility. This position is responsible for inspecting fabricated steel components, welds, and protective coatings to ensure compliance with project requirements, industry standards, and internal quality procedures.

This role is primarily based on the production floor and requires frequent interaction with fabrication personnel. The work environment is an active manufacturing facility with limited office time and exposure to changing temperatures.

Primary Responsibilities
  • Inspect fabricated structural steel assemblies for quality, accuracy, and specification compliance.
  • Verify work meets applicable industry requirements, including AWS D1.1, AWS D1.5, AISC, and other relevant standards.
  • Perform inspections of incoming materials, components, and welding consumables before production use.
  • Identify, document, and track inspected materials according to established quality procedures.
  • Maintain inspection reports, quality records, and related documentation.
  • Calibrate and maintain welding equipment and quality inspection instruments.
  • Assist with welder qualification testing and certification activities.
  • Support training related to welding procedures, fitting practices, and quality standards.
  • Maintain drawing control and other quality system documentation.
  • Partner with production and leadership teams to investigate and resolve quality issues.
  • Participate in continuous improvement initiatives and ongoing safety programs.
  • Promote safe work practices throughout the facility.
Required Qualifications
  • At least 2 years of experience in structural steel fabrication.
  • Previous experience in quality inspection, quality control, or a similar manufacturing position.
  • Working knowledge of AWS D1.1, AWS D1.5, and AISC standards.
  • Ability to read and interpret fabrication drawings, blueprints, and project specifications.
  • Experience using quality inspection tools, including:
    • Fillet weld gauges
    • V-WAC gauges
    • Squares
    • Tape measures
    • Standard inspection and measuring equipment
  • Ability to work independently while managing multiple inspection tasks.
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to producing high-quality work.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Current Certified Welding Inspector (CWI) certification.
  • Experience performing or supporting nondestructive testing methods, including:
    • Ultrasonic Testing (UT)
    • Magnetic Particle Testing (MT)
    • Penetrant Testing (PT)
  • Additional certifications related to structural steel fabrication, welding inspection, coatings, or bolting.
  • Previous experience working in a structural steel manufacturing environment.
Work Environment
  • Production floor-based position with minimal office work.
  • Non-climate-controlled manufacturing facility.
  • Regular standing, walking, and inspecting materials throughout the shift.
